Top failures
Why does the tool cut fine then suddenly fail mid-project?
Pattern: The most common regret is heat inconsistency, which appears repeatedly across feedback.
When it shows: This happens after the first 5–30 minutes of cutting, and it gets worse during long, continuous sessions.
Category contrast: This is more disruptive than typical mid-range cutters, which usually maintain steady temperature for long cuts.
Is frequent wire breakage expected?
- Primary sign: Wire snapping or thinning often appears after normal hobby use.
- Frequency tier: This is a primary issue reported more often than other faults.
- Cause: Stress from heavy-duty cuts and fluctuating heat accelerates wire wear.
- Impact: Breaks cause project downtime and add replacement costs.
- Fixability: Replacing wires works short-term but does not remove repeat replacements.
What hidden upkeep will surprise first-time buyers?
- Hidden requirement: Buyers must frequently clean the heated tip with a copper brush to avoid blackening and hardening.
- Early sign: Dark residue appears quickly after initial uses if not cleaned.
- Frequency tier: This is a secondary, persistent friction point for regular users.
- Cause: The product's high surface temperature and material off-gassing build residue faster than expected.
- Impact: Unclean tips reduce cut quality and raise the chance of wire failure.
- Hidden cost: Extra wires and brushes add ongoing expense and interruptions.
- Category contrast: This model needs more upkeep than most mid-range alternatives, increasing time and effort for similar results.
Will the included accessories and power supply hold up?
- Accessory quality: Some buyers report the case and holder are flimsy under workshop conditions.
- Power concerns: The adapter is UL/FCC labeled, but users report overheating during extended use.
- Usage anchor: Problems usually appear during prolonged work sessions or when cutting dense foam.
- Impact on safety: Overheating and unstable accessories together raise the chance of interruptions and hazard avoidance behaviors.
- Attempts to fix: Users often reduce session length or add external ventilation to keep the unit usable.
- Repairability: The unit is repairable at a component level, but that adds time and skills buyers may not expect.
- Category contrast: These accessory and heat-safety issues are more pronounced than in typical mid-range cutters.
- Final note: For heavy daily use, this combination increases long-term hassle compared with sturdier options.

Safer alternatives

- Choose models with a proven thermal cutout to neutralize the overheating failure.
- Prefer cutters that use thicker, reinforced wires to reduce the risk of breakage.
- Buy spare replacement wires and a quality tip brush in advance to reduce downtime from maintenance.
- Look for kits with metal cases and stronger holders if you want to avoid accessory fragility.
- Read reviews about long-session performance to avoid units with frequent mid-project failures.
